On-Demand Training Dispatch via ml_training_service

Goal

Extend ml_training_service to dispatch GPU training jobs as K8s Jobs, collect results via a Rust sidecar uploader, and auto-promote models with operator approval via fxt.

Context

  • GitLab CI pipeline handles scheduled/manual full-ensemble retraining (10 models × N symbols)
  • ml_training_service handles on-demand single-model retraining via gRPC, dispatches K8s Jobs to the gpu-training pool
  • Both coexist: CI for bulk runs, service for operational on-demand jobs

Architecture

fxt CLI / web-gateway
        │ gRPC
        ▼
ml_training_service (no GPU needed)
        │
        ├─ Creates K8s batch/v1 Job ──► gpu-training pool
        │     ├─ main: training binary (exits on completion)
        │     └─ sidecar: training-uploader (K8s 1.34 native sidecar)
        │           ├─ watches /output/DONE marker
        │           ├─ uploads artifacts to S3
        │           └─ calls ReportJobCompletion gRPC
        │
        ├─ Receives completion callback
        │     ├─ registers checkpoint in DB
        │     └─ compares metrics vs active model
        │
        └─ If better → "pending_promotion"
              └─ operator: fxt model approve <id>
                    └─ updates active model pointer

Components

1. K8s Job Dispatcher

New module in ml_training_service. Uses kube crate to create batch/v1 Jobs programmatically. Reuses existing infra/k8s/training/job-template.yaml structure.

Injects into Job spec:

  • Model type, symbol, data dir, output dir
  • S3 credentials (from K8s secret)
  • Callback endpoint (service ClusterIP + port)

Watches Job status via K8s API as fallback if sidecar callback fails.

2. training-uploader (new crate)

Small Rust binary (~300 lines) in crates/training_uploader/.

Behavior:

  1. Watches for /output/DONE (success) or /output/FAILED (error) marker
  2. Reads /output/metrics.json for training metrics
  3. Uploads /output/models/ directory to S3 via object_store crate
  4. Calls ReportJobCompletion gRPC on ml_training_service
  5. Exits (K8s native sidecar with restartPolicy: Always)

Uses same S3 stack as crates/storage (object_store crate, Scaleway S3-compatible).

3. ReportJobCompletion RPC

New unary RPC in ml_training.proto:

rpc ReportJobCompletion(JobCompletionReport) returns (JobCompletionAck);

message JobCompletionReport {
  string job_id = 1;
  string s3_path = 2;
  bool success = 3;
  string error_message = 4;
  map<string, double> metrics = 5;
}

message JobCompletionAck {
  bool accepted = 1;
  string promotion_status = 2;  // "pending_promotion", "no_improvement", "error"
}

On receipt:

  • Registers checkpoint via existing CheckpointManager
  • Compares metrics against active model version
  • If better → sets status to pending_promotion
  • Broadcasts update to SubscribeToTrainingStatus subscribers

4. Model Promotion Flow

New RPCs:

  • ListPendingPromotions — models awaiting approval
  • ApprovePromotion(model_id) — promote pending model to active
  • RejectPromotion(model_id) — archive checkpoint, keep current

On approval: updates active model pointer in DB. model_loader picks up on next refresh cycle.

5. fxt CLI Commands

New subcommands:

  • fxt train <model> <symbol> — trigger on-demand training
  • fxt train status [job-id] — show running/recent jobs
  • fxt model list — show models with active/pending status
  • fxt model approve <id> — promote pending model
  • fxt model reject <id> — reject pending model

Changes Summary

Component Change
ml_training_service K8s Job dispatcher, ReportJobCompletion RPC, promotion logic
ml_training.proto 4 new RPCs (ReportJobCompletion, ListPendingPromotions, Approve, Reject)
New crate training_uploader S3 upload + gRPC callback binary
Dockerfile.training Add training-uploader binary
K8s job template Add native sidecar container
fxt CLI train and model subcommands
Training binaries Write DONE/FAILED marker + metrics.json on exit

Unchanged

  • GitLab CI pipeline (bulk retraining)
  • S3 storage layout and bucket config
  • Existing training binaries (minimal change: marker file only)
  • CheckpointManager and ModelStorageManager (reused)
  • model_loader crate (reads active model pointer)

Not in Scope

  • Automatic degradation detection triggering retraining (future — trading_service already tracks metrics in QuestDB)
  • Multi-symbol batch dispatch (use CI pipeline)
  • Hyperopt via service (use CI pipeline)

Infrastructure

  • K8s: 1.34 (native sidecar support confirmed)
  • GPU pool: gpu-training (L4)
  • S3: Scaleway Object Storage (foxhunt-gitlab-artifacts bucket)
  • Registry: rg.fr-par.scw.cloud/foxhunt-ci
  • PVCs: training-data-pvc (RO input), training-output-pvc (RWX NFS output)
